In all honesty, I only picked up the Unibond AERO 360 Compact Moisture Absorber (which is currently on offer for just £12 at Amazon) when grabbing a few bits and bobs in my local Tesco as it was on offer at the front of the shop when I walked in. 

Come Autumn, window condensation in our old cottage is a massive problem and every day ours are streaming with condensation when we wake up in the morning. I was hoping that this little device could help a bit.
